As a modern supply chain becomes more and more complex, companies turn to 3PL operators to ensure that goods are delivered to a retail store or to a customer’s door on time and at a better price / quality ratio. For many enterprises and companies 3PL operators are vital, they implement all the business processes associated with logistics. With the help of a 3PL provider you can solve personnel tasks, inventory control, inventory, transportation of goods and order processing. And the client can focus on business development, sales and marketing.
The European market clearly demonstrates the advantage of logistics through 3PL operators over their own logistics companies. Will the Russian logistics market follow the European trend and how to build effective relationships with the logistics operator?
